School enrollment of school-age children (ages 3-17) from the American Community Survey 5-year estimates (detailed table B14003), for Georgia at state, county, school district, and census tract geography, vintages 2020-2024: the share of children enrolled in public school, private school, or not enrolled, with the underlying counts and margins of error.

Limitaciones
Universe: SCHOOL-AGE children (ages 3-17) by deliberate scoping - the source table covers population 3+, where adult non-enrollment would dominate the not_enrolled share. The public/private split is the Census school-type split (nursery through college), not K-12 enrollment specifically: a 16-year-old enrolled in college counts in public or private per their institution. not_enrolled is concentrated among 3-4-year-olds (pre-K non-attendance). The school-age denominator and its margin are derived by aggregating the 24 source cells (the table publishes no 3-17 total), so the count margins are sqrt-sum-of-squares approximations applying the Census zero-estimate rule (of the member cells whose estimate is zero, only the largest margin enters the sum); share margins use the Census proportion-MOE formula (ratio-form fallback when the radicand is not positive), and a margin above 1.0 is NULLed. ACS 5-year period estimates: the year column is the vintage END year and each estimate pools five years of survey responses (2024 = 2020-2024). Consecutive vintages share about 80% of their sample, so the series is heavily smoothed - never difference overlapping vintages as if they were annual change. Estimates are survey-based and carry 90% margins of error (the *_moe columns); tract-level margins can be large relative to the estimate. All levels serve vintages 2020-2024 only, on 2020-vintage tract boundaries. State rows have NULL county_fips, district_code, and tract_geoid; county rows carry only county_fips, district rows only district_code, tract rows only tract_geoid. District rows cover the ~180 standard (city/county) districts only: the Census publishes school-district estimates at unified school district geography, which has no codes for charter schools, RESAs, or state agencies, and its few Census-only districts (e.g. the Fort Stewart military district) have no GCD district code and are dropped.
